Why We Like The Brooks Canopy Jacket
The Brooks Canopy Jacket gives us lightweight weather protection with plenty of packability. The fabric is designed to seal out light moisture and wind, and it's highly breathable to release steamy moisture vapor and keep us drier on the run. The adjustable hood can also be stowed inside the collar while the whole jacket packs down into a built-in backpack, so we can stow-and-go and whip it out when the weather turns wet or windy.
Details
- Lightweight and packable running jacket
- DriLayer seal is wind- and water-repellent for light protection
- Hood is adjustable and stowable
- Unzip and use draft flap snaps for ventilation
- Includes integrated backpack for packability
- Made with recycled materials to reduce environmental impact

March 30, 2024
THE jacket for running in rain and wind
This is THE jacket for running in the rain. I had tried a rain jacket from Nike before this and it was so unbreathable it felt like wearing a trash bag. I really wanted a rain jacket that I wouldn’t sweat to death in. The canopy jacket is somehow breathable and yet keeps me dry in some pretty serious rain. It’s super soft and comfy to wear too. It has a lot of nice features like a little button to hold the hood down when you’re not wearing it and it’s really cool how it packs into a little back pack. It is very lightweight so when it’s cold out I wear a long sleeve under it and it keeps me very warm. Sizing wise, I’m 5’6” 135 lbs and I got a size M (I’m usually a small but I wanted to be able to layer under it) and it’s perfect. It doesn’t look baggy but I can comfortably fit a long sleeve under. I’m super glad I bought it and have never seen another rain/wind jacket for running like it.

September 4, 2023
Great for AK rain
I love this jacket! I live in AK and the summers here are very rainy. This jacket has withstood many training runs and one half marathon so far. I love that you can unzip when you get too warm and there are snaps to keep jacket in place. Pockets are great for gels and keys/ID. The hood is very nice and stays on pretty well. I wish it was a little easier to stow to the rolled up position while running, otherwise it just flaps behind you in the wind since it so lightweight, but that my problem as I’m not sure how they could make that easier. One thing I’m not in love with on this jacket is the wrist part of the sleeves. It constantly rubs on my watch which ends up sometimes pausing my run for me, also there no elastic in the wrist to help hold the sleeve up when you start to get warm. For reference I’m 5’6 about 155lbs and the Large fits well—a little roomy for added layers on colder runs.
